Seasoned journalists will host two of WUSF’s most popular broadcast shows |
TAMPA, Fla. (April 13, 2022) – WUSF Public Media welcomes Craig Kopp and Matthew Peddie as new hosts for two of the radio station’s premiere broadcasts, “Morning Edition” and “Florida Matters” respectively. “ WUSF is fortunate to bring aboard two exceptionally talented hosts as Craig and Matthew,” said WUSF General Manager JoAnn Urofsky. “Morning Edition and Florida Matters are important shows at WUSF, and we are proud to have them in the hands of experienced hosts.” Craig Kopp will begin hosting “Morning Edition” this week. Produced by National Public Radio, “Morning Edition” airs 5 a.m. to 9 a.m. weekdays, and takes listeners around the country and the world. It includes a series of local news segments that are produced by WUSF, and Kopp will be the Tampa-based host. Kopp is returning to WUSF, having served previously in a number of roles at the station. A well-known figure in Tampa Bay broadcasting, Kopp has worked with a range of organizations, including Florida Politics, WMNF radio Tampa, WEKU Richmond, Aspen Public Radio, The Poynter Institute for Media Studies and the University of South Florida Zimmerman School of Advertising and Mass Communications. Matthew Peddie will host Florida Matters. Peddie takes the place of long-time WUSF host Bradley George who is relocating to North Carolina. Peddie comes to WUSF from the Orlando-area public radio station, WMFE, and brings substantial familiarity with current issues in Florida politics, the environment, health, education and more. Additionally, he has worked in news organizations including freelance reporting for National Public Radio, Radio New Zealand and more. Florida Matters is a public affairs program that tackles tough issues and provides deeper perspective on what it means to live in the Sunshine State. The show airs on WUSF 89.7 Tuesdays 6:30 p.m. to 7 p.m. and on Classical WSMR 89.1 and 103.9 Mondays 10:00 p.m. to 10:30 p.m. and is also distributed as a stand-alone podcast available on all major podcast platforms.
